Transaction 3937207d55ddd0d6f0919e4d86b0bd1842a629679f59168bd52c7aebea0d8246
1 Input
1 Output
-
3937207d55ddd0d6f0919e4d86b0bd1842a629679f59168bd52c7aebea0d8246:0
- value
- 1066394
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2dc353cca841a5421dd72821c7bea373903fafdc OP_EQUAL
- address
- 35rzKkuJ16UJBu2DznCTRvZbmgL1t8Ph9T